Vivo V70 FE 5G Review
The Vivo V70 FE 5G enters the premium mid-range smartphone market with a clear goal: deliver flagship-inspired features at a more affordable price. Instead of focusing on raw benchmark numbers alone, Vivo has built a phone that emphasizes design, camera quality, display excellence, and exceptional battery life. The result is a smartphone that feels far more premium than its price tag suggests.
At first glance, the Vivo V70 FE impresses with its slim profile despite housing an enormous 7000mAh BlueVolt battery. The phone features a vibrant 6.83-inch AMOLED display with a 120Hz refresh rate, a powerful 200MP primary camera with Optical Image Stabilization (OIS), and a 50MP autofocus selfie camera. Powering everything is the MediaTek Dimensity 7360 Turbo chipset, paired with fast LPDDR5 RAM and UFS 3.1 storage for smooth everyday performance. The addition of IP68 and IP69 water resistance, NFC, IR Blaster, reverse charging, and Android 16 further strengthens its premium appeal.
The Vivo V70 FE is not designed to compete directly with flagship gaming phones. Instead, it focuses on offering a balanced experience where photography, multimedia, battery endurance, and premium aesthetics take priority. For users looking for a stylish smartphone that can comfortably handle work, entertainment, social media, photography, and everyday multitasking, it presents a compelling package.
Design & Build Quality ★★★★★ (9.3/10)
One of the biggest highlights of the Vivo V70 FE is its design. Even with a huge 7000mAh battery inside, the phone measures only 7.6mm thick, making it surprisingly slim and comfortable to hold. The curved edges, balanced weight distribution, and premium finish give the device a flagship-like feel.
The available color options, including Northern Lights Purple and Monsoon Blue, add a modern and elegant touch. Vivo's design language is clean, minimal, and visually appealing without becoming overly flashy. The phone feels solid in hand, and the overall construction inspires confidence during daily use.
Durability is another strong point. The Vivo V70 FE carries both IP68 and IP69 certifications, providing excellent protection against dust and water. This level of durability is still uncommon in the premium mid-range category and gives users additional peace of mind when using the phone outdoors or in challenging environments.
The optical in-display fingerprint scanner is quick and accurate, while the overall button placement remains ergonomic and easy to access. Despite the large battery, the phone avoids feeling excessively bulky, which is a notable engineering achievement by Vivo.

Display ★★★★★ (9.4/10)
The Vivo V70 FE features a 6.83-inch AMOLED display that immediately stands out for its vibrant colors, excellent contrast, and impressive sharpness. With a resolution of 1260 × 2800 pixels and a pixel density of around 449 PPI, text appears crisp, images look detailed, and videos are highly enjoyable.
The 120Hz refresh rate significantly improves the overall user experience by making scrolling, animations, and gaming feel fluid and responsive. Whether browsing social media, reading articles, or navigating the interface, the display consistently feels smooth.
HDR10+ support enhances streaming quality by delivering better contrast and richer colors when watching compatible content. The AMOLED panel also produces deep blacks, making movies and games look more immersive.
Outdoor visibility is impressive thanks to the display's high brightness levels, allowing comfortable use even under direct sunlight. Combined with accurate color reproduction and wide viewing angles, the screen becomes one of the phone's strongest selling points.
For multimedia lovers, the Vivo V70 FE offers an excellent viewing experience that rivals many more expensive smartphones.

Performance & Gaming ★★★★☆ (8.7/10)
The Vivo V70 FE is powered by the MediaTek Dimensity 7360 Turbo, a modern 4nm octa-core chipset designed to balance performance with power efficiency. While it isn't intended to compete with flagship processors like the Snapdragon 8 Elite or Dimensity 9400, it delivers a smooth and responsive experience for everyday users.
Paired with 8GB LPDDR5 RAM and UFS 3.1 storage, the phone launches apps quickly, switches between multiple applications effortlessly, and maintains smooth system performance even during extended usage. Daily tasks such as browsing, social media, video streaming, document editing, and multitasking are handled without noticeable slowdowns.
Benchmark results also place the chipset among the stronger performers in the premium mid-range category. Combined with Vivo's software optimization, the overall user experience remains fluid throughout the day.
Gaming performance is equally respectable. Popular games like BGMI, Call of Duty Mobile, PUBG Mobile, Asphalt Legends, Mobile Legends, and Free Fire MAX run smoothly at high graphics settings with stable frame rates. Casual gamers will have an excellent experience, while competitive players may occasionally need to reduce graphics settings in extremely demanding titles to maintain maximum frame rates.
Thermal management is another positive aspect. Even during long gaming sessions, the Vivo V70 FE manages heat efficiently and avoids excessive throttling. Features like Bypass Charging further improve gaming comfort by reducing battery heat while charging.

Camera Review ★★★★★ (9.5/10)
The Vivo V70 FE is clearly built with photography in mind. Its 200MP primary camera with Optical Image Stabilization (OIS) captures highly detailed photos with impressive sharpness and vibrant colors in daylight conditions. Images display excellent dynamic range, accurate exposure, and pleasing contrast without looking overly artificial.
The 8MP ultra-wide camera expands creative possibilities by allowing users to capture landscapes, architecture, and large group photos. While image quality is naturally lower than the primary sensor, it remains useful in good lighting conditions.
One of the standout features is the 50MP autofocus front camera, which produces detailed selfies with natural skin tones and excellent sharpness. Autofocus ensures faces remain crisp even when shooting from different distances, making it ideal for selfies, video calls, and content creation.
Night photography is also impressive thanks to the large primary sensor, OIS, and Vivo's AI processing. Low-light images retain good detail while controlling noise effectively. Portrait mode offers accurate edge detection, creating professional-looking background blur.
Video recording supports 4K resolution on both the rear and front cameras, delivering sharp footage with reliable stabilization. Various camera modes, including Night Mode, Portrait, Panorama, Pro Mode, Underwater Photography, Time-lapse, Slow Motion, Super Moon, Dual View, and Ultra HD Document Mode, make the camera system versatile for different scenarios.
Although the camera performs exceptionally well overall, image processing can occasionally be slightly aggressive in certain lighting conditions. Nevertheless, it remains one of the strongest camera systems available in its price category.

Battery & Charging ★★★★★ (9.8/10)
Battery life is undoubtedly one of the Vivo V70 FE's biggest strengths. The massive 7000mAh BlueVolt battery easily delivers a full day of heavy usage and can comfortably stretch into a second day for moderate users. Whether you're gaming, streaming videos, attending online meetings, browsing social media, or taking photos throughout the day, battery anxiety is rarely an issue.
Charging is equally impressive. The included 90W FlashCharge technology rapidly refills the battery, minimizing downtime and ensuring the phone is ready to go quickly. Vivo has also included Reverse Charging, allowing the device to power accessories or other smartphones when needed.
A particularly useful feature for gamers is Bypass Charging, which powers the phone directly from the charger during gaming sessions. This reduces battery heat, improves efficiency, and helps extend long-term battery health.
Power optimization in Android 16 further enhances battery endurance through intelligent background management and adaptive power-saving features.

Software & User Experience ★★★★★ (9.2/10)
The Vivo V70 FE runs on Android 16 with Vivo's latest software experience, delivering a clean, responsive, and feature-rich interface. The software feels well optimized for the MediaTek Dimensity 7360 Turbo chipset, ensuring smooth animations, fast app launches, and excellent memory management.
AI plays a significant role in enhancing the user experience. Features such as AI Transcript Assist, AI Note Assist, AI Live Text, AI Screen Translation, Circle to Search, AI Erase 3.0, AI Image Expander, and AI Magic Move improve both productivity and creativity. These tools make the phone more useful for students, professionals, and content creators alike.
Vivo has also optimized battery management and background processes, allowing the phone to maintain consistent performance without unnecessary power consumption. Overall, the software experience feels polished, intuitive, and suitable for both first-time Android users and experienced smartphone enthusiasts.

Connectivity & Multimedia ★★★★★ (9.3/10)
The Vivo V70 FE offers a comprehensive set of connectivity features expected from a premium smartphone. It supports Dual SIM 5G, Bluetooth 5.4, USB Type-C, NFC, IR Blaster, Wi-Fi, and multiple satellite navigation systems including GPS, GLONASS, Galileo, BeiDou, and NavIC for accurate location tracking.
Multimedia performance is equally impressive. The AMOLED display delivers vibrant visuals, while the dual stereo speakers provide loud and balanced sound with good clarity for movies, gaming, and music playback.
Additional premium features like IP68/IP69 water resistance, in-display fingerprint scanner, face unlock, and Bypass Charging further enhance the overall user experience and make the Vivo V70 FE feel like a true flagship-inspired device.
